Introduction to Peristaltic Dispensing Pumps

Peristaltic dispensing pumps play a crucial role in various industries, including pharmaceuticals, food and beverage, and water treatment. These pumps operate by moving fluids through a flexible tube, using rollers to create a vacuum that draws the liquid through the system. This method ensures accurate and consistent fluid delivery, making them an ideal choice for precision applications. Standard Peristaltic Pumps

Standard peristaltic pumps are widely used across various industries due to their simplicity and reliability. These pumps are designed for general-purpose applications where consistent fluid flow is necessary. Typically, they feature a robust construction and are capable of handling a range of viscosities. Standard peristaltic pumps are particularly favored in settings such as laboratory environments, water treatment facilities, and agricultural applications. Their ease of use and maintenance make them accessible for many users, contributing to their popularity in the U.S. market.

OEM Peristaltic Pumps

O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) peristaltic pumps are specifically designed for integration into larger systems or machinery. These pumps cater to manufacturers looking to include reliable fluid dispensing solutions within their products. OEM pumps often feature compact designs and customizable options, enabling them to fit seamlessly into various applications. They are essential in industries such as medical devices, automation systems, and laboratory equipment. The demand for OEM pumps in the Global is growing as manufacturers increasingly seek versatile components that can enhance the functionality of their products.

Food and Beverage Peristaltic Pumps

Food and beverage peristaltic pumps are engineered to meet stringent sanitary standards required in the food processing industry. These pumps are constructed with materials that comply with food safety regulations, ensuring no contamination occurs during fluid transfer. They are ideal for handling sensitive ingredients, such as dairy products, sauces, and beverages, where hygiene and reliability are paramount. In the North America, the rising focus on food quality and safety is driving the demand for specialized pumps, thus boosting the growth of this segment in the peristaltic pump market.

Pharmaceutical Peristaltic Pumps

Pharmaceutical peristaltic pumps are crucial in the healthcare sector, where precision and sterility are non-negotiable. These pumps are designed to deliver accurate dosages of sensitive compounds, including active pharmaceutical ingredients and sterile solutions. The U.S. pharmaceutical industry is characterized by stringent regulatory requirements, making the reliability of dispensing pumps vital. Peristaltic pumps in this segment often incorporate advanced technology, including smart monitoring systems, to ensure compliance and maintain high standards of accuracy. As the pharmaceutical market expands, the demand for specialized peristaltic pumps continues to rise, reflecting their importance in drug manufacturing and delivery systems.

1. What is a peristaltic dispensing pump?

A peristaltic dispensing pump is a type of positive displacement pump used for the precise dispensing of fluids by squeezing and releasing a flexible tube.

2. What are the key applications of peristaltic dispensing pumps?

Peristaltic dispensing pumps are commonly used in medical and laboratory settings, as well as in the pharmaceutical and food and beverage industries.
